The Koningsdam will tour Europe on a series of Premiere Voyages before returning to the Netherlands on May 20, 2016 for her naming ceremony. After the official christening, ms Koningsdam will spend the summer sailing a series of Northern European itineraries before moving to the Mediterranean in the fall. In late October she’ll reposition to Ft. Lauderdale, Florida, her grateful homeport for a sunny season in the Caribbean.
The Koningsdam accommodates 2,650 guests and beautifully applies new design concepts to the line’s always elegant aesthetic. Guests will enjoy a host of new public spaces, entertainment venues and culinary pleasures, along with all of the much-loved amenities currently enjoyed throughout the fleet. Plus, for the first time ever, Holland America is offering Family Ocean-view Staterooms which were designed specifically for families with two separate shower facilities and extra closet space to accommodate up to five guests. Of course, guests will also have a wide array of glamorous suites to choose from, including the 1,357-square-foot Pinnacle Suite.
Music played a vital role in the Koningsdam’s design, and nowhere is this more apparent than along the Music Walk, a series of musically-themed entertainment venues covering all genres. It’s here that Lincoln Center Stage features classical recitals and chamber music performances, while Billboard Onboard is an energetic tribute to today’s most popular hits. Last, and definitely not least, is the World Stage – home to five new productions taking full advantage of the theater’s 270-degree LED displays and multiple stage configurations.
Culinary highlights include Sel de Mer, a new French seafood restaurant offering a new take on timeless classics, along with a spectacular Culinary Arts Center featuring a dramatic show kitchen and personal cooking stations for hands-on workshops and demonstrations. To top it all off, you can even pair your meals with wines mixed yourself at BLEND, the first winemaking experience at sea.
